From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from dpdk.org (dpdk.org [92.243.14.124]) by inbox.dpdk.org (Postfix) with ESMTP id EC5E9A052B; Tue, 28 Jul 2020 11:24:52 +0200 (CEST) Received: from [92.243.14.124] (localhost [127.0.0.1]) by dpdk.org (Postfix) with ESMTP id CBCA61C10A; Tue, 28 Jul 2020 11:24:52 +0200 (CEST) Received: from foss.arm.com (foss.arm.com [217.140.110.172]) by dpdk.org (Postfix) with ESMTP id 3A3091C0DB; Tue, 28 Jul 2020 11:24:51 +0200 (CEST) Received: from usa-sjc-imap-foss1.foss.arm.com (unknown [10.121.207.14]) by usa-sjc-mx-foss1.foss.arm.com (Postfix) with ESMTP id AF5F830E; Tue, 28 Jul 2020 02:24:50 -0700 (PDT) Received: from net-arm-thunderx2-02.shanghai.arm.com (net-arm-thunderx2-02.shanghai.arm.com [10.169.210.119]) by usa-sjc-imap-foss1.foss.arm.com (Postfix) with ESMTPA id 1D17F3F66E; Tue, 28 Jul 2020 02:24:47 -0700 (PDT) From: Ruifeng Wang To: Thomas Monjalon , Ruifeng Wang Cc: akhil.goyal@nxp.com, david.marchand@redhat.com, dev@dpdk.org, honnappa.nagarahalli@arm.com, nd@arm.com, stable@dpdk.org Date: Tue, 28 Jul 2020 17:24:04 +0800 Message-Id: <20200728092406.9259-2-ruifeng.wang@arm.com> X-Mailer: git-send-email 2.17.1 In-Reply-To: <20200728092406.9259-1-ruifeng.wang@arm.com> References: <20200727085810.168970-1-ruifeng.wang@arm.com> <20200728092406.9259-1-ruifeng.wang@arm.com> M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it Subject: [dpdk-dev] [PATCH v2 1/3] crypto/armv8: remove log debug option X-BeenThere: dev@dpdk.org X-Mailman-Version: 2.1.15 Precedence: list List-Id: DPDK patches and discussions List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: dev-bounces@dpdk.org Sender: "dev" Typo in debug log switch macro caused debug log cannot be enabled. Since no log used in data path, remove the debug option entirely and have logs always enabled. Resolved compilation error when debug log is enabled: rte_armv8_pmd.c: In function ‘process_armv8_chained_op’: rte_armv8_pmd.c:633:22: error: expected ‘)’ before ‘crypto_func’ ARMV8_CRYPTO_ASSERT(crypto_func != NULL); ^ Fixes: 169ca3db550c ("crypto/armv8: add PMD optimized for ARMv8 processors") Cc: stable@dpdk.org Reported-by: David Marchand Signed-off-by: Ruifeng Wang --- config/common_base | 1 - drivers/crypto/armv8/armv8_pmd_private.h | 11 ++--------- 2 files changed, 2 insertions(+), 10 deletions(-) diff --git a/config/common_base b/config/common_base index f76585f16..c70b8f68b 100644 --- a/config/common_base +++ b/config/common_base @@ -605,7 +605,6 @@ CONFIG_RTE_CRYPTO_MAX_DEVS=64 # Compile PMD for ARMv8 Crypto device # CONFIG_RTE_LIBRTE_PMD_ARMV8_CRYPTO=n -CONFIG_RTE_LIBRTE_PMD_ARMV8_CRYPTO_DEBUG=n # # Compile NXP CAAM JR crypto Driver diff --git a/drivers/crypto/armv8/armv8_pmd_private.h b/drivers/crypto/armv8/armv8_pmd_private.h index e08d0df78..19940809b 100644 --- a/drivers/crypto/armv8/armv8_pmd_private.h +++ b/drivers/crypto/armv8/armv8_pmd_private.h @@ -15,7 +15,6 @@ RTE_STR(CRYPTODEV_NAME_ARMV8_CRYPTO_PMD), \ __func__, __LINE__, ## args) -#ifdef RTE_LIBRTE_ARMV8_CRYPTO_DEBUG #define ARMV8_CRYPTO_LOG_INFO(fmt, args...) \ RTE_LOG(INFO, CRYPTODEV, "[%s] %s() line %u: " fmt "\n", \ RTE_STR(CRYPTODEV_NAME_ARMV8_CRYPTO_PMD), \ @@ -29,17 +28,11 @@ #define ARMV8_CRYPTO_ASSERT(con) \ do { \ if (!(con)) { \ - rte_panic("%s(): " \ - con "condition failed, line %u", __func__); \ + rte_panic("condition failed, line %u", \ + __LINE__); \ } \ } while (0) -#else -#define ARMV8_CRYPTO_LOG_INFO(fmt, args...) -#define ARMV8_CRYPTO_LOG_DBG(fmt, args...) -#define ARMV8_CRYPTO_ASSERT(con) -#endif - #define NBBY 8 /* Number of bits in a byte */ #define BYTE_LENGTH(x) ((x) / NBBY) /* Number of bytes in x (round down) */ -- 2.17.1